Tune Your Own Bike
Two hours on your own bike, ending with it shifting and braking better than it walked in. You do the adjusting, a Laneway mechanic talks you through it.
What we cover:
- Indexing front and rear gears, and what the limit screws actually do
- Cable tension, and spotting worn cables and housing
- Checking derailleur hanger alignment, the hidden cause of bad shifting
- Disc brake adjustment: pad clearance, rotor rub and lever reach
- Tyre pressure that suits you, not the number on the sidewall
- Finding and fixing creaks and rattles
Suits mechanical and electronic drivetrains, road and MTB. Home Mechanic Essentials first is helpful but not required.
